Tromper, the little dog, wished he was a dock jumper, and so he started out as a beginner. He found a wonderful place to learn how to dock jump and was loving it until some fears and doubts began to bother him. If he doesn't overcome these doubts with courage and action he is going to be stuck. He is frightened he will lose his new found home. Follow Tromper on his courageous path that he builds one step at a time. This is a story children can connect to to help them understand that: Feeling uncertain is okay. They are not alone because we all have doubts and fears that challenge us. They can use their courage to take action. They are capable of accomplishing great things step by step, strengthening their perseverance and resilience as they move forward.
